"We're always looking for better ways to connect members with shows and films that they will love," a Netflix spokesperson told CNN. The shuffle button will take the user's viewing activity into account when shuffling - possibly drawing from the same algorithm that helps build out its recommendations on its home page. The service includes plenty of content that's aimed just at kids, for example, or is in a language a user might not speak. The button would live under the user's profile on the home screen and, thankfully, won't be random for all of Netflix's offerings. Or maybe people are just bored - shuffle is here to solve many problems. The company has been tweaking its interface over the past few years (autoplaying trailers, adding rows, customizing profiles) and now, with a large boost in viewership thanks to the pandemic keeping everyone on their butts and inside, it's the perfect time to test out a feature for those who may have already watched everything they'd planned to on the service. Netflix confirmed to CNN that the company is testing out the idea, which - like the shuffle button for music services - randomly pick something in the service's catalog, be it TV show or movie, to play.
